                                        On a DSM getting your ECU chipped is really going to do nothing for you. The nice benefit of the AFC is that it is tricking the ECU into thinking its still running the small injectors which in turn will let the ECU still give full timing advance. When chipping the ECU to compensate for the larger injectors it will no longer give you that full timing advance. Run a stock ECU and a AFC!!
